Not all dairy is made equal: theres a huge difference between just plain milk and kefir. Although kefir is a dairy product and is made from milk, the most important thing to consider is how its made. The process of fermenting milk to produce kefir provides probiotics the healthy kind of bacteria. The fermentation process also consumes most of the sugar specifically, lactose, which makes it an option suitable for those who are lactose intolerant. The probiotics found in fermented dairy drinks completely changes the nutritional properties and are particularly important for a healthy gut and body. The misconception that dairy leads to inflammation stems from the belief that consumption of milk with genetically modified growth hormone has the potential to change human hormone levels, but the latest research in 2017 from a study reviewing clinical evidence between dairy products and inflammation could not find sufficient evidence to support the validity of this claim. The claims between inflammation and dairy did not account for poor diet choices, lack of exercise, and stress which are all potential contributors that may be associated with inflammation-related diseases.

What Kind Of Probiotic Drinks To Buy

If you choose to go the drinkable probiotics route, Erin Palinski-Wade, R.D., C.D.E., author of The 2-Day Diabetes Diet and Newgent recommend the fermented milk beverage kefir as a healthy drinkable probiotic.

Newgent recommends Lifeway Kefir since they have a wide range of probiotic-rich products that are also excellent sources of protein, calcium, and vitamin D. Newgent also gives a thumbs up to GoodBelly’s StraightShot probiotic drink because it’s certified organic with only 30 calories per “shot” and contains no added sugars.

“If you prefer to drink your probiotics, make sure the label mentions the strains of probiotics it contains as well as the CFUs to know how much probiotic you are actually getting,” says Palinski-Wade.

As we’ve previously reported, looking for a number indicates that it’s strain-specific type, which tend to be well-researched and higher quality. For daily use, experts recommend probiotics with 5 to 15 billion colony-forming units per serving since less may be ineffective, and long-term use of very high doses hasn’t been well studied.

Since everyone’s microbiome is different, it might mean trying a few different probiotic brands until you find the one that gives you the biggest benefit.

Which Is Better Yakult Or Yakult Light

Yakult Light contains 50% fewer calories and less sugar than Yakult. Yakult Light contains 25 calories whereas our Yakult product contains 50. But they both are packed with live and active probiotic Lactobacillus casei Shirota.

What Probiotic Drinks Can

Food/Drink Review: Epoca Cool Plus Probiotic Cultured Dairy Beverage

Probiotics can’t…

Work digestive miracles in minutes. If you’re hoping that chugging a probiotic drink will help you “detox” after a particularly indulgent weekend or “clean your system” so you feel more regular, know that taking any kind of probiotic won’t produce an immediate bowel movement like taking a laxative would, Palinski-Wade says. “However, over a period of time, regular consumption can help to improve regularity, decrease GI bloat, and combat constipation,” she says.

Probiotics can

Be a great complement to your fitness routine. If you’re regularly following a strenuous training routine, you could be suppressing your immune system and making your body more susceptible to infection. Since probiotics can help to strengthen the immune system, consuming them regularly can benefit athletes and avid exercisers alike, says Palinski-Wade.

Dextrose And Other Sugarsmore Sugar

Another ingredient in the popular probiotic drink Yakult is dextrose.

Dextrose is a simple sugar, and in Yakult’s case, it is derived from tapioca. Not quite as bad as the standard sucrose sugar . However, it is still a simple carbohydrate. As if we didn’t have enough sugar from the second ingredient, we now have some more!

I should point out that some of the sugar is used in the fermentation process to grow the bacteria used in Yakult’s probiotic drinks.

Yakult Light replaces sugar in it’s ingredients list with other sweeteners such as stevia, maltitol and ploydextrose.

Maltitol and polydextrose don’t have an significant effect on blood sugar levels for people consuming it compared to ordinary table sugar .

One study states that:

“The chronic administration of maltitol induced no variations of glycemia or insulinemia when compared with the same dose of sucrose”

Another study shows a slightly less “peaky” curve with regard to blood sugar levels:

“The peak of the stimulation of glucose oxidation occurred 60 min after the load of sucrose and 90 min after the load of maltitol. The delta glucose oxidation was significantly lower with maltitol than with sucrose during the first 90 min after the ingestion of the load. It was slightly higher with maltitol than with sucrose starting from the 210th min. Maltitol resulted in a cumulated suprabasal glucose oxidation which amounted to 40% that obtained with sucrose after 180 min.”

Where To Find Probiotics

Probiotics are found in yogurt and other fermented dairy products like kefir, naturally aged cheese like Gouda, fermented soybean foods like miso and tempeh, naturally fermented sour pickles and cabbage like sauerkraut and kimchi, sourdough bread, and the fermented tea kombucha, says Newgent.

“You can get plenty of probiotics from foods you eat,” Newgent says. “If you’re regularly eating foods rich in probiotics, purchasing these probiotic drinks isn’t necessary, especially if you’re on a tight food budget.” But it’s certainly fine to opt for a probiotic beverage, especially if you have minor digestive issues or don’t regularly consume natural food sources of these good bacteria, says Newgent.

Why Probiotic Drinks Are Everywhere

Epoca Cool Plus Probiotic Dairy Drink 50 x 2.1 oz.

According to a recent Beverage Industry report, probiotic drinks and other “functional beverages” are the hottest bottled beverages to claim space in your grocer’s refrigerator section. Labels often claim benefits like “detoxifying” and “energy-boosting.”

While the FDA hasn’t approved any health claims for any probiotics, and these “good bacteria” aren’t considered essential to our diet, probiotics have become important in maintaining a healthful gut and stronger immunity, says Jackie Newgent, R.D.N., C.D.N., author of The With or Without Meat Cookbook. “Probiotics help maintain the natural balance of organisms in our intestines and can help treat and potentially prevent GI issues, such as diarrhea, irritable bowel syndrome, and those resulting from antibiotic treatment,” she says.

Probiotics And Skin Health

Studies indicating a correlation between dairy consumption and acne did not account for fermented dairy, which may contribute to different results due to the presence of probiotics. Skin issues such as acne may be an indicator of internal imbalances. Because the skin is our largest organ, poor nutrition choices may show up there first. Kefir contains a diverse count of probiotics that may help restore a natural balance of good vs. bad bacteria in the gut. Restoring the balance of intestinal microflora can help tame issues related to the stomach that result in skin problems. A balanced gut microflora can also help the body absorb more nutrients from food.

Update On Yakult’s Effectiveness:

Epoca Cool Plus Beverage – Foodz Unbox 186

After communication with Yakult Australia, they pointed out that the study listed on the SuppVersity website was not conclusive evidence that the strain of bacteria was ineffective. They also claimed that their strain was well-researched and proven to improve health conditions.

The Leber study in question concluded:

Gut permeability of MetS patients was increased significantly compared with healthy controls. L. casei Shirota administration in the MetS patients did not have any influence on any parameter tested possibly due to too-short study duration or underdosing of L. casei Shirota.
